RESOLUTION CLASS 6(B) REAL ESTATE TAX INCENTIVE FOR THE BENEFIT OF CORK PROPERTIES, LLC AND REAL ESTATE LOCATED AT 317 NORTH FRANCISCO AVENUE AND 335 NORTH FRANCISCO AVENUE
IN CHICAGO, ILLINOIS PURSUANT TO COOK COUNTY, ILLINOIS REAL PROPERTY ASSESSMENT CLASSIFICATION ORDINANCE

WHEREAS, the Cook County Board of Commissioners has enacted the Cook County Real Property Assessment Classification Ordinance, as amended from time to time (the "Ordinance"), which provides for, among other things, real estate tax incentives to property owners who build, rehabilitate, enhance and occupy property which is located within Cook County and which is used primarily for industrial purposes; and
WHEREAS, the City of Chicago (the "City"), consistent with the Ordinance, wishes to induce industry to locate and expand in the City by supporting financial incentives in the form of property tax relief; and
WHEREAS, Cork Properties, LLC, an Illinois limited liability company (the "Applicant"), is the owner of certain real estate located at 317 North Francisco Avenue and 335 North Francisco Avenue, Chicago, Illinois 60612, as further described on Exhibit A hereto (the "Subject Property"); and
WHEREAS, the Applicant leases a portion of the Subject Property to Chicago Flyhouse, Inc., an Illinois corporation (the "Tenant"), and Tenant uses said property its rigging business operations related to performance flying and stage automation, and for related uses; and
WHEREAS, the Applicant intends to rehabilitate an approximately 50,000 square foot industrial facility located on the Subject Property; and
WHEREAS, following the rehabilitation, the Applicant plans to lease a portion of the Subject Property to the Tenant and to lease the remaining portions of the Subject Property to other tenants yet to be determined; and
